Bathing place
Bathing place
Cura DesignCura Design
+ wet room constructed with natural lime render walls + natural limestone floor + cantilevered stone shelving + simple affordable fittings + bronze corner drain + concealed lighting and extract + No plastic shower tray, no shower curtain, no tinny fittings + demonstrates that natural materials and craftsmanship can still be achieved on a budget + Photo by: Joakim Boren

Timeless Traditional, Master Bathroom
Timeless Traditional, Master Bathroom
Simply Baths & KitchensSimply Baths & Kitchens
When designer Rachel Peterson of Simply Baths, Inc. first met this young, stylish couple at their house they had a small handful of items they knew they really wanted in their master bathroom: a freestanding tub, a chandelier, a larger shower and more counter space. But the truth was, the bath needed a major face-lift. The space was outdated and lacked personality. It certainly didn't reflect the homeowners and their elegant aesthetic. The combination of stone and wood tiles lends just enough of a rustic flair to bring a little bit of the outdoors in and while helping to balance some of the feminine elements in the room with simple masculine touches.
